Nestled in a chic former brewery, this trendy boutique hotel features striking art, upscale dining, and high-tech rooms, all within a lively shopping haven.

This hotel is much smaller than it looks from the outside...perhaps having only 3 or 4 rooms per floor. So it is a real boutique hotel.||||We booked a chic boutique room and were lucky enough to be on the street side on the 3rd floor, so the room had plenty of daylight and privacy. Most parts of the room were great. Lovely shower. The toilet is uncomfortable. The bed was good. The ceilings must be 15 feet high. The use of a cell phone for guests is weird and unnecessary. The flatscreen TV was very old and slow to operate. ||||We were told the mini bar was complimentary only to discover this not to be the case at the end. Fortunately it wasn't as expensive as it could have been. ||||If you need nearby laundry service, there is a very affordable place nearby called Pralnia Lavami that will wash your clothes quickly, sometimes within 3 hours, for 33 zloty per load. ||||The location is good. There are a lot of shops nearby in the attached mall. Note that the shops are closed on most Sundays. There is a nice park next door and walking through that gets you to the old town and all of the sites there.||||My only real quibble is that the housekeeping service kept turning the AC down to 10 degrees C. This is bad enough, but they also left the windows open.

I stayed there for three nights during my trip to Poznan. ||The hotel is well located, near to everything, they have even a door straight to the shopping mall.||I was thinking that the hotel was kind of modern art museum. People behind it did a really great job. ||Service was excellent, they offer you an iPhone that you can use to call and surf, you can even use it as a room key.||Chopard products, Bang & Olufsen TV and Illy café... A luxury Boutique Hotel to visit!

It’s an interesting hotel, not your average boring room but the style simply doesn’t help the rooms function. |The lighting is complicated to operate and there is no lighting which allows you to put make up on!! |If you have the curtains open people outside and in the hotel opposite can watch you shower!! |There is a gap between the toilet door and the room, as there is no door handle inside the toilet. This allows all the smells into the room.|There is a small wardrobe but nowhere for storing non-hanging items; I used the windowsill.|There are no tea and coffee facilities in the room.|The plug sockets are in the wrong places to be useful.|However it’s an unusual and interesting place to visit and you get a complementary drink in the bar.
